Max Verstappen makes worrying ‘struggling' claim about Red Bull

It looked for all the world that Max Verstappen would pick up yet another sprint race victory in Brazil, as the Dutchman started second on the grid with only the Haas of Kevin Magnussen ahead of him on pole. The Haas was expectedly easy to clear, which Verstappen did on the second lap, and with both Mercedes behind him he looked set to go on and claim a comfortable victory and start the main race from pole. Other than Nicholas Latifi, Verstappen was the only driver to race on the medium compound tyres, with everyone else using the softs that they saved in the wet qualifying sessions.
